Do you want to work on one of the biggest K8s projects in Europe - one running over 400 Pods (and 140k Nodes) at any one time?
Do you want to get AWS & CKA certified on company time whilst also using these tools day in day out in production environments?
I am partnered with one of the world’s top tech consultancies who are spearheading a huge multi-year DevOps transformation at a Govt department in the North. The project aims to completely revolutionise the way the UK Government operates online and will create numerous public benefits including cutting waiting times, vastly improved CX and cost savings in the millions of pounds.
They are now looking for Senior and Lead Platform Engineers to join their team and help with the ongoing support, optimisation and scaling of this project. Their ideal candidate would be an expert within:
- Cloud: AWS, GCP, Azure
- Kubernetes: Helm, Kops, ServiceMesh, Istio
- IaC: Terraform, Ansible
- CI/CD: GitOps, Github Actions, Jenkins
- Observability: OTel, Dynatrace, Grafana
- Linux: RedHat, Ubuntu, Debian
